Recent Performance Trends
Analyzing the Hawks' performance in their last few games reveals a team that's been fighting hard but facing challenges. In a closely contested battle against Orlando Magic, the Hawks fell short by six points, with a final score of 108-114. Despite this setback, there were positive takeaways from the game, including solid bench contributions and a commendable effort in points scored off turnovers.
However, it wasn't all gloom for Atlanta; they showcased their scoring prowess in an epic showdown against New York Knicks that went into overtime. Although they narrowly lost by one point with a final score of 148-149, the game highlighted Atlanta's offensive capabilities and resilience under pressure.
In another matchup against Orlando Magic away from home, the Hawks managed to secure a victory with a six-point lead (112-106), demonstrating effective field goal percentages and capitalizing on turnovers. This win underscored Atlanta's potential when they execute well on both ends of the floor.
